What is binary fission?

Prepare for the Culinary Certification Exam. Use our flashcards and multiple-choice questions, each with hints and detailed explanations. Ace your exam!

Binary fission is the method through which bacteria reproduce. This process involves a single bacterial cell replicating its genetic material and then dividing into two identical daughter cells. Each new cell contains the same DNA as the original, allowing for rapid population growth in favorable conditions. Understanding this process is crucial in culinary practices, particularly when focusing on food safety and hygiene, as bacteria can multiply quickly, which may lead to foodborne illnesses if proper precautions are not taken.
